A transgenic Oryza saitva L. cell line was used to produce hCTLA4Ig with RAmy3D promoter.1) This promoter is induced strongly when sugar is exhausted in culture media. Although RAmy3D promoter system enables transgenic rice cells to express recombinant proteins highly, the cells in the phase of induction cannot maintain their viability because there are no energy sources in culture media. Therefore, it is necessary to supply another energy source which does not suppress the promoter with the maintenance of cell viability. It has been reported that the rice cells used acetate in advance as a carbon source when glucose and acetate were mixed in the culture media.2,3) This study investigated the effects of acetates as an alternative energy source
on the cell viability as well as the production of hCTLA4Ig in transgenic rice cell suspension cultures.
